Cardinal Mccloskey School And Home For Children

The cardinal mccloskey school and home for children (d/b/a cardinal mccloskey community services) (the "agency") is a non-sectarian social service agency which serves abused and neglected children, at-risk families and developmentally disabled adults. the agency provides care to thousands of children and families from new york city, westchester and rockland counties through twenty one different programs including: foster boarding homes; adoption services; independent living programs; emergency residential care; family counseling; at risk services; parenting training; group day care; family day care and meals program; as well as group homes, day habilitation and service coordination for adults with developmental disabilities.
